As the popularity of MMA fighting continues to grow thanks to the programming at the television stations and within the media, there has been a surge of new fitness classes that are offering you the chance to be able to get all of the fitness benefits that the sport has to offer, without all of the kicks, punches and blood that you could be more used to seeing.
Fitness instructors have realised that to be able to not only last the duration of one of the MMA fights but to be able to also deal with the potentially devastating blows that an opponent can deliver at anytime during a competitive fight, the participants have to have a huge amount of both mental and physical strength to continue to fight.
Knowing that many of you will not be looking to take up a hobby which is likely to see you taking a fist, forearm or kick to the face, they have taken out the contact element of the sport and have developed a training regime that you will have never seen before.
The massively strenuous workout will see your body pushed to the limit, speeding up all of the elements within your body that will enable fast weightloss and impressive fitness gains, all through a serious of resistance exercises as well as cardiovascular focused activities.
